WWE's SmackDown is brought to you Live from the home of the world's best barbecue sauce,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. A new opening video begins the program and we come right into Ford Center for the entrance of Montel Vontavious Porter. Introductions are made as we see MVP and Dolph Ziggler in the ring and we're set for an Intercontinental Championship match.

Dolph Ziggler w/ Vickie Guerrero vs. MVP
Intercontinental Title match

Ziggler's on top early on and he goes to put a sleeper on MVP. MVP forces him away and Ziggler eventually falls to ringside. Just then we see Nexus members Michael Tarver, Heath Slater, David Otunga and Justin Gabriel make their way toward the ring. They come manacingly down the ramp and the ref calls for the bell as Nexus take apart first Dolph Ziggler and then MVP.
No Contest.

Nexus stalk, corner and then pummel MVP in the ring after doing a number on Ziggler at ringside. Justin Gabriel finishes off MVP with a 450 splash. We next hear the crowd cheer though as the world's largest athlete makes his way to the ring. Big Show marches fearlessly into the realm of Nexus and he's then quadruple-teamed and battered to ringside. John Cena's music hits and he runs full speed down to the ring, but again Nexus run the show. Just then, Big Show comes in with a steel chair! He smashes Heath Slater in the back and Nexus escape to then retreat up the ramp. Wade Barrett, leader of Nexus, comes on screen to promise everyone that this is the last time they will have seen Nexus beat down John Cena because "come Sunday at Hell In A Cell, Cena will become part of Nexus." Barrett then says that he's friends with the President of Syfy and his friend has given him the liberty of suggesting some matches for tonight's Premiere of SmackDown. Teddy Long reluctantly then announces that Big Show will face all of Nexus in a Five-on-One Handicap match. John Cena will face the Devil's Favorite Demon, the World's Heavyweight Champion; Kane!

CM Punk vs. The UnderTaker

UnderTaker is scary, he's eerily enigmatic and 'Taker dominates this contest from the get-go. He's very different from his demeanor at Night of Champions. 'Taker hits his leg-drop on the apron, he nails Punk with Old School and he thwarts any of Punk's attacks by sitting up after Punk hits a high knee and a bulldog. UnderTaker looks like The UnderTaker we saw at WrestleMania, The UnderTaker who ended the career of Shawn Michaels and in the ring we see 'Taker hit the Snake Eyes before taking CM Punk up and chokeslamming him straight to hell. 'Taker then toys with the soul of CM Punk and finally puts his nail in Punk's coffin with a deadly Tombstone! One! Two! Three!

Winner: The UnderTaker!

Kane vs. John Cena
Lumberjack match - Nexus are Lumberjacks

Kane is on top in the early going and the Big Red Monster does well to floor Cena early to get a Two-count. Kane sends Cena to ringside and Nexus of course batter and beat him before throwing him back into the ring with Kane. The World Champion dominates Cena in SmackDown's season Premiere. Cena gets a few hits in, but nothing stops Kane other than himself. Kane misses the clothesline off the top rope and Cena goes on to hit a series of shoulder barges and he then performs the Five-Knuckle Shuffle. Kane soon falls to ringside and Nexus don't attack. They climb the apron and target Cena and it's not long before both Kane and Cena are fighting off Nexus members. Cena eventually ends up backing off up the ramp. Meanwhile Kane's back in the ring and the lights go out *BONG*...
Match thrown out.

*BONG* UnderTaker's in the ring and he attacks his brother. 'Taker stalks Kane and he persues him as the fight goes into the crowd. Kane comes back into it, but 'Taker is always in control. They fight back to ringside and 'Taker smashes Kane's head off the top of the steel stairs. UnderTaker unloads on Kane as he mounts him and batters him with hard right hands at ringside. Cena and Nexus are nowhere to be seen as this is all about the gate-keepings of hell. Kane gets on top back in the ring and Kane slaps his hand around 'Taker's neck for a chokeslam but then we see Paul Bearer with the urn and 'Taker overpowers Kane to chokeslam the World Champion! UnderTaker signals for the Tombastone, but Kane rolls out of the ring and backs off as far as he can. *BONG* What's going to happen this Sunday when the brothers collide once more for the World Heavyweight Championship inside Hell In A Cell?!
